Industry: Software Development > Creative Media
OpenChord presents a compelling solution tailored to a unique niche in the music notation industry, focusing on underrepresented genres like Gregorian chant. This appeals to both musicians and educators who often face challenges with existing notation tools.

|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| What specific problem does this startup idea solve? | It provides accessible tools for notating and typesetting complex and niche musical arrangements, a need often unmet by mainstream music software. |
| Who are the target customers or users for this solution? | Musicians, composers, music educators, and religious institutions with an interest in traditional and sacred music genres. |
| What existing alternatives or competitors address this problem? | Mainstream music notation software like Finale and Sibelius, though these typically focus on broader, more commercial music needs. |
| What unique value proposition does this idea offer compared to alternatives? | It specifically targets niche genres with a community-driven approach, offering features tailored to unique musical traditions. |
| What potential revenue streams or monetization strategies could this idea support? | Premium features, subscription models for educational institutions, and sales of custom plugins. |
| What are the biggest technical or operational challenges to implementing this idea? | Building a robust and user-friendly platform that effectively handles complex notations, and cultivating a strong developer community. |
| Why is now the right time for this solution? | Growing interest in traditional music and open-source software makes this a favorable moment for OpenChord’s launch. |
| What initial resources would be needed to launch an MVP? | Skilled developers with experience in music software, a core set of community managers, funding for initial platform development. |
| What key metrics would indicate success for this startup? | User engagement and growth rates, community contributions, revenue from premium features, and user satisfaction levels. |
| What are the most significant risks or assumptions that need validation? | Assumptions regarding user demand in the niche, the platform’s ability to attract contributors, and competition from established software. |
